# IA-3(1) Cryptographic Bidirectional Authentication
> **Enhancement of:** IA-3
## High-Level Description
**Family:** Identification and Authentication (IA)
**Framework:** NIST SP 800-53 Rev 5
A local connection is a connection with a device that communicates without the use of a network. A network connection is a connection with a device that communicates through a network. A remote connection is a connection with a device that communicates through an external network. Bidirectional authentication provides stronger protection to validate the identity of other devices for connections that are of greater risk.

## Remediation Guide
### Control Statement
Authenticate [organization-defined] before establishing [organization-defined] connection using bidirectional authentication that is cryptographically based.
### Implementation Guidance
A local connection is a connection with a device that communicates without the use of a network. A network connection is a connection with a device that communicates through a network. A remote connection is a connection with a device that communicates through an external network. Bidirectional authentication provides stronger protection to validate the identity of other devices for connections that are of greater risk.
